On June 23rd, Meta Platforms (META) exhibited a significant technical event, triggering a 'Power Inflow' signal at 10:19 AM at a price of $687.14. This indicator, derived from order flow analytics, points to substantial institutional buying pressure, often referred to as 'smart money' activity, concentrated within the first two hours of trading. The signal proved effective in the short term, as META's stock subsequently rallied to a high of $699.05 and closed at $698.53, delivering a 1.7% return from the signal level by the end of the session. The event, which registered a strongly positive sentiment score of 0.85 for the ticker, underscores the potential influence of institutional order flows on intraday price momentum and confirms the market's bullish interpretation of this specific technical development.
